[QUOTE="rolfw, post: 34442, member: 175057"] If you are using an offset bracket, rather than a preset monobloc LNB, then the primary focus sed LNb will automatically be pointing at the centre, the offset however, can be pointed well off centre and still produce passable results. To produce optimum results, it really does need to be pointing exactly at the centre and also be at the correct focal length, it is not unknown for bracket bending to be effective. [/QUOTE]
